What they do
A Medical Secretary provides secretarial work that requires specialized knowledge of medical terminology and procedures, insurance and billing processes and medical records management. Works with physicians and other clinicians. May gather intake information from patients scheduled for appointments at an office.

In this vital role, you will serve as the first point of contact for patients, providing exceptional customer service while managing a variety of administrative and clinical support tasks. Your energetic approach will ensure smooth clinic operations, accurate documentation, and efficient patient flow. The ideal candidate will possess strong computer skills, familiarity with electronic health record (EHR) systems, and a passion for delivering compassionate patient care. Responsibilities Greet patients warmly and professionally, ensuring a positive first impression. Schedule appointments using medical office management software such as Epic, Meditech, or Athenahealth. Verify patient insurance information, process payments, and handle medical collections with accuracy. Manage electronic health records (EHR) systems, including documentation review and data entry in platforms like eClinicalWorks or Meditech. Assist with medical billing processes, including CPT coding, ICD-9/10 coding, and Medicare claims submission. Answer multi-line phone systems with excellent phone etiquette, directing calls appropriately and taking detailed messages. Maintain patient records securely in compliance with HIPAA regulations and clinical confidentiality policies. Support clinical staff by preparing care plans and updating medical records as needed. Perform clerical duties such as filing, data entry, typing (including 10 key), and managing office supplies to ensure an organized workspace. Facilitate communication between patients and healthcare providers to promote seamless care delivery. Requirements Proven experience as a Medical Receptionist or in a similar medical administrative support role within a clinical setting. Proficiency with EMR/EHR systems such as Epic, Meditech, Athenahealth, or eClinicalWorks. Strong knowledge of health insurance processes including medical billing, collections, Medicare procedures, and health information management. Familiarity with medical terminology, CPT coding, ICD coding (ICD-9/10), and documentation review standards. Excellent customer service skills coupled with professional phone etiquette and communication abilities. Ability to handle multiple tasks efficiently while maintaining attention to detail in a fast-paced environment. Bilingual skills are preferred to serve diverse patient populations effectively. Office experience with Microsoft Office Suite (Word, Excel) is highly desirable. Knowledge of clinical confidentiality policies and HIPAA compliance is essential. Strong organizational skills with experience managing electronic health records (EHR) management and medical records filing.
